Job description

About Granite State Gaming & Hospitality, LLC

Granite State Gaming & Hospitality, a subsidiary of G2 Gaming, is committed to supporting community nonprofit organizations in New Hampshire through innovative entertainment, hospitality and gaming experiences. Our accomplished team of industry professionals have more than 150 years of experience and are ready to take charitable gaming to a whole new level; creating world-class venues, infusing more economic opportunities into the markets we serve while helping New Hampshire nonprofits thrive. We believe our innovative player experiences and enhanced operations can be a partnership that helps provide valuable resources directly to those organizations that are helping our friends and neighbors. We are currently open and developing first class gaming venues in Rochester, Hampton, and Littleton.

What You'll Expect

The Dual Rate Cage Supervisor/Cashier is responsible for performing all cage cashier functions while also acting in a supervisory capacity when assigned. This role ensures efficient, accurate, and compliant financial transactions within the casino cage, provides excellent guest service, and supports departmental operations in accordance with company policies and gaming regulations.

What You'll Do
  • Oversee daily cage operations, ensuring accuracy, compliance, and proper staffing levels
  • Assist cashiers with transaction issues, approvals, variances, and procedural questions
  • Review and verify cashier paperwork, banks, transactions, and system reports
  • Conduct audits of cashier drawers and safe funds; investigate and resolve discrepancies
  • Train, mentor, and evaluate cage personnel, ensuring adherence to best practices
  • Enforce Title 31/AML compliance and complete required reporting
  • Communicate effectively with management, surveillance, security, and other departments
  • Support problem resolution, guest service escalations, and emergency procedures
  • Process a wide range of monetary transactions, including check cashing, currency exchanges, marker issuance/payments, credit card advances, and chip redemptions
  • Balance cash drawer and maintain accurate records of all transactions
  • Verify identification, authenticate documents, and follow anti-money-laundering (AML) procedures
  • Handle guest inquiries professionally and provide exceptional customer service
  • Maintain the security and integrity of all funds, keys, forms, and cage assets
  • Adhere strictly to internal controls, gaming regulations, and company policies
